Saw Supersized Earth on the BBC the other night. Grabbed these screen shots of the engine being put together for this massive container ship being built in South Korea. Some crazy 2 stroke diesel engine with torque figures in the millions of Nm

Yeah there are 2 episodes and both worth watching. That is in fact the crank shaft and casing they are about to drop it into. Bore size I believe is 90cm and is a very long stroke. CC is huge per cylinder.
